🇬🇧 English

The law, enacted on May 17, 2013, legalizes marriage for same-sex couples in France, amending the Civil Code to state that marriage can be contracted by two individuals of the same sex. It not only allows same-sex marriage but also aligns various family provisions to ensure equal treatment for same-sex couples and their children, including adoption rights. Additionally, the law recognizes previously contracted same-sex marriages and allows their transcription in France, ensuring that they are treated equally under the law.

Key Changes

  • Establishes that marriage can be contracted by two people of the same sex or different sexes.
  • Aligns provisions regarding parental responsibilities and adoption rights for same-sex couples.
  • Recognizes and allows for the transcription of same-sex marriages contracted before the law's enactment.
